Lap Banker - Four Indonesian University students, which is Clara Princess Andini, Hajtun Nazilahn, Vercha, and Nandita Princess, is executing an independent internship program in the Plain Province Communication Service as an implementation of direct learning in the workforce. This event became one of the steps students in developing professional skills, communication skills, and real work experiences in the government environment.

During an internship, students were involved in various activities related to information technology, digital communication, administration, to the management of data and public information services. Through that experience, students can understand the process of professional work as well as improve adaptation, teamwork, and responsibility for completing the task.

This self-training program is also a means for students to apply the science that has been studied during the course into direct practice in government agencies. In addition to getting work experience, students are expected to be able to build professional relations and improve readiness in the face of the workforce after completing education.

This internship was guided by a professor of the University of Teknowrat Indonesia, Yura Fernando, S.Kom., M.Kom, who gave orders and mentorship during the internship process. With the presence of this program, students are expected to be able to be competent, adaptive, and ready to compete in the digital age as well as the modern working world.
